19.09.2019“The first year of the Clean Air programme is now a history. It is the first programme with such an immense scope in the history of Poland geared towards the improvement of air quality, which provides subsidies for thermal modernisation of single-family homes, as well as replacement of old heating sources,” said Henryk Kowalczyk, Minister of Environment, during a press conference. The meeting with the media, which took place on 19 September 2019 in Bytom, was also attended by Prime Minister Mateusz Morawiecki and the President of the National Fund for Environmental Protection and Water Management Piotr Woźny.

18.09.2019The two-day 19th Congress of Rural Municipalities in Ossa near Biała Rawska was attended by Minister of Environment Henryk Kowalczyk, who was its honorary guest. The main issues covered during the congress included air quality and changes in the waste management system. The panellists also debated water and sewage management, as well as repatriation of Poles from the former Soviet republics.
